Understanding Your Bankroll
Every successful gambling strategy begins with a clear understanding of your bankroll. Your bankroll is the amount of money you set aside specifically for gambling, distinct from your everyday finances. It’s essential to determine this figure before you start playing, as it helps you establish how much you can afford to lose without affecting your financial well-being. By segmenting your finances in this way, you gain a solid foundation for your gambling journey. Once you’ve determined your bankroll, it’s crucial to stick to it. Many gamblers fall into the trap of chasing losses, which can lead to significant financial distress. Setting strict limits on your sessions and remaining disciplined can prevent you from overspending. For instance, if you allocate $500 for a month, stick to that limit regardless of whether you’re winning or losing. This discipline ensures that gambling remains an enjoyable activity rather than a source of stress.
Additionally, consider using a budgeting approach to enhance your bankroll management. This might involve breaking your bankroll into smaller units for each gaming session. If you decide to use $50 per session, you can enjoy multiple sessions without depleting your entire bankroll at once. This strategy not only prolongs your gambling experience but also provides you with the opportunity to reassess your tactics after each session, optimizing your overall strategy for success.

Setting Win and Loss Limits
Establishing win and loss limits is a fundamental aspect of responsible gambling that supports effective bankroll management. A win limit is the point at which you decide to walk away after achieving a certain amount of profit. This practice prevents greed from influencing your decisions, which can lead to detrimental outcomes. For example, if you set a win limit of 50% of your bankroll, once you reach that target, you can cash out and enjoy the fruits of your labor.
On the other hand, a loss limit serves as a safety net, protecting you from excessive losses. This limit should be established before you start playing and adhered to rigorously. For instance, if you decide to only lose 20% of your bankroll in a single session, once you hit that mark, it’s time to take a break. This approach not only protects your finances but also helps maintain your mental health while gambling.
Implementing these limits requires self-discipline but can significantly impact your long-term success. Adhering to your limits may mean walking away at times when you feel you could keep playing; however, it ultimately strengthens your ability to manage your bankroll effectively. Over time, this practice fosters a healthier gambling attitude, allowing you to enjoy the experience without succumbing to financial pressures.
